Frequently Asked Questions

Get answers to common questions about Relaxers.

Relaxers usually last three to six months depending on hair growth, texture, and aftercare. Individual results vary; we'll assess your hair during consultation and recommend maintenance schedules to preserve curl shape and hair health between touch-up appointments.

Yes, many color-treated or processed hairs can receive Relaxers, but we perform a strand and scalp test first. Treatment plans may be adjusted to reduce overlap, prevent damage, and ensure safe, beautiful results for compromised hair.

Absolutely. We use a variety of rod sizes and sectioning techniques to customize curl diameter and placement. Your stylist consults on desired volume and face-framing so the finished look complements your features and personal styling preferences.

Safety depends on hair and scalp condition. We conduct a thorough consultation and sensitivity test; alternative formulations or gentler techniques may be recommended. Our priority is preserving hair integrity, so sometimes we advise against chemical processing until hair health improves.

Maintain results with sulfate-free shampoos, moisturizing conditioners, and hydrating masks. Avoid excessive heat and overlapping chemical services. Schedule follow-up trims and use recommended at-home products to protect curl structure and hair strength between salon visits.

Appointment length varies with hair length, density, and chosen curl pattern but generally ranges from two to three hours. Consultations and processing times are included; arrive with clean, dry hair to help ensure accurate timing and best results.
